Abstract

An ontology-cored emotional semantic retrieval model was proposed and constructed in order to overcome the current situation that it is difficult to implement emotional semantic search in the course of image searching. A method Combines Mpeg-7, theory of concept lattices and ontology construction together to construct the kernel ontology library was put forward. The difficulty of this method lies on how to integrate the Mpeg-7 standard descriptor with image emotional ontology properties, and how to auto-generate new concept results. Related experiments were carried out of which the results validated the feasibility of this model on image emotional semantic search. © 2010 Springer-Verlag Berlin Heidelberg.
